global:
  rbac:
    pspEnabled: false

###
# Theodolite resources
###

kafkaClient:
  enabled: true
  nodeSelector:
    env: dev
  

####
## configuration of sub charts
###

###
# Grafana
###
grafana:
  service:
    nodePort: 31399  
  rbac:
    create: true
    pspEnabled: false 
    namespaced: true
  nodeSelector:
    env: dev


###
# Confluent Platform 
###

cp-helm-charts:
  enabled: true
  ## ------------------------------------------------------
  ## Zookeeper
  ## ------------------------------------------------------
  cp-zookeeper:
    nodeSelector:
      env: dev

  ## ------------------------------------------------------
  ## Kafka
  ## ------------------------------------------------------
  cp-kafka:
    nodeSelector:
      env: dev

  ## ------------------------------------------------------
  ## Schema Registry
  ## ------------------------------------------------------
  cp-schema-registry:
    nodeSelector:
      env: dev


###
# Kafka Lag Exporter
###
kafka-lag-exporter:
  nodeSelector:
    env: dev
  clusters:
    - name: "theodolite-explorviz-cp-kafka"
      bootstrapBrokers: "theodolite-explorviz-cp-kafka:9092"


###
# Prometheus Monitoring Stack (Prometheus Operator)
###
kube-prometheus-stack:
  prometheusOperator:
    namespaces:
      releaseNamespace: true
      additional: []
    nodeSelector:
      env: dev


###
# Prometheus
###
prometheus: 
  nodeSelector:
    env: dev

###
# Theodolite Operator
###
operator:
  enabled: false

serviceAccount:
  create: false

rbac:
  create: false

randomScheduler:
  enabled: false